After spending a weekend trying out EQ2-Extended for free...

I downloaded and logged on to Project 1999 last night.

In one of my early fights, I got killed by a wooly spiderling [You must be logged in to view images. Log in or Register.]

Then I attacked a skeleton, but did not notice that it was the Vengeful Lyricist wandering around everfrost [You must be logged in to view images. Log in or Register.] I died.

I died a couple more times from Bear or Spider adds.I played for about 2 hours off and on and am not level 3 yet. I have like 1 gold, not all of my spells, and a few piece of cloth armor and my newbie club.

In three hours of EQ2-Extended, I had like +stats all over my equipment, I was level 15, I had been led by the nose through like 1298213 meaningless quests, fights took about 10 seconds, and I was bored out of my mind.

Yes, the original Everquest is a far different animal than the crap that is out there today.It is just more difficult, and a better game for it.
